Hi! I'm Jeffrey Bingham Mead, pictured above at the front door of the Bush Holley House National Historic Site and headquarters of the Greenwich Historical Society.  

The Greenwich, A Town For All Seasons Show started its broadcast history on September 26, 2018 on Radio 1490 WGCH Greenwich, Connecticut and WGCH.com  anywhere. The show airs every-other Wednesday morning starting at 9:00 a.m. 

This is the first time in Greenwich's history  that there has been a radio show specifically dedicated to the town's rich heritage and culture. I've been blessed with some superb guests showcased during the Talk of the Town conversation segment. 

Born and raised in Greenwich, I am a direct descendant of one of its founding families. My background and interests are varied and ever-evolving. In an earlier chapter in my life I was a former board member and trustee of the Greenwich Historical Society and former local history contributing writer at Greenwich Time in the 1980s and 1990s.

Today I continue as a member of the Capt. Matthew Mead Branch of the Connecticut Society of the Sons of the American Revolution; an adjunct university professor and lecturer in the states of Hawaii and Connecticut; president and co-founder of History Education Hawaii, Inc., the Hawaii Council of the National Council for History Education (since 2006); president/founder of the Historic Mead Family Burying Grounds Association, author of Chains Unbound: Slave Emancipations in Greenwich, Connecticut, and more.

From Greenwich Free Press: "The show seeks to build bridges between past and present; feature local business, historical news and cultural events for long-time residents and newcomers alike; entertain, contribute to and heighten knowledge of the history of Greenwich, Connecticut and ultimately do its part in its sustained preservation.” 

“We’re looking forward to establishing long-term strategic partnerships with the town’s historic preservation organizations, its citizens and expats all over the world. Greenwich is a town for all seasons and all people -everyone is invited to our celebration of the town’s culture and heritage,” Mead added.
